Understanding Hydraulic Floor Jack Seal Kits
Hydraulic floor jacks are essential tools in both professional automotive workshops and home garages. They are designed to lift heavy vehicles and equipment with ease, employing the principles of hydraulics to amplify force. However, like any mechanical tool, hydraulic jacks can encounter issues over time, particularly with their seals. This is where hydraulic floor jack seal kits come into play.
The Importance of Seals in Hydraulic Jacks
Seals in hydraulic jacks serve a critical role. They prevent hydraulic fluid leakage, maintain pressure, and ensure the effective operation of the jack. When seals wear out or become damaged, it can lead to several problems, including a loss of lifting power, increased operation time, and potential safety hazards. Recognizing the signs of damaged seals is crucial for timely maintenance. Common indicators include visible fluid leaks, reduced lifting capacity, or the jack failing to hold a load.
What is a Hydraulic Floor Jack Seal Kit?
A hydraulic floor jack seal kit is a collection of replacement seals specifically designed for hydraulic floor jacks. These kits typically include different types of seals, such as O-rings, piston seals, and backup rings, tailored to fit various brands and models of floor jacks. Purchasing a seal kit allows users to repair their hydraulic jacks instead of replacing the entire unit, saving money and extending the life of their equipment.
Choosing the Right Seal Kit
When selecting a hydraulic floor jack seal kit, compatibility is paramount. Not all hydraulic jacks use the same seals; therefore, it's essential to identify the make and model of your jack first. Check the manufacturer’s specifications or consult user manuals to ensure you get the correct parts. Additionally, consider the quality of the seals in the kit. High-quality materials, such as polyurethane or nitrile rubber, are essential for longevity and performance, as they can withstand the high pressures and temperatures associated with hydraulic fluid.
How to Replace Seals Using a Seal Kit
Replacing seals in a hydraulic floor jack can be a straightforward process if you follow these steps
1. Safety First Ensure the jack is not under load and disconnected from any power source. Wear appropriate safety gear, such as gloves and goggles, to protect yourself. 2. Disassemble the Jack Carefully disassemble the jack by removing the handle and other components to access the hydraulic cylinder. Make sure to keep track of screws and parts for reassembly.
3. Remove Old Seals Take out the old seals from their respective locations. This may require the use of a seal puller or flathead screwdriver. Be cautious not to scratch or damage the cylinder walls.
4. Install New Seals Lubricate the new seals with hydraulic oil before installing them. This helps them fit properly and reduces wear during operation. Carefully place each seal according to the configuration provided in the seal kit instructions.
5. Reassemble the Jack Once all seals are replaced, reassemble the jack in the reverse order of disassembly. Ensure all components are secured tightly.
6. Test the Jack After reassembly, test the jack to ensure it lifts smoothly and holds pressure without leaks. If you encounter issues, double-check the seal installation.
